Types of Parrots Commonly Found in Shelters
Although numerous types of parrots may be offered for adoption, the following list highlights the ones most frequently found in shelters:
Budgerigar (Budgie): These little, colorful birds are friendly and reasonably easy to take care of.Cockatiel: Known for their affectionate nature, cockatiels are terrific companions and can be quickly trained.Lovebird: These small parrots are lively and take pleasure in mingling, making them outstanding family pets.African Grey: Highly intelligent and social, African Greys need lots of interaction however can form strong bonds with their owners.Amazon Parrots: Known for their singing abilities and lively spirit, Amazons can be very appealing companions.Table: Characteristics of Common ParrotsParrot SpeciesSizeLife-spanSocial NeedsVocalizationBudgerigarSmall5-10 yearsModerateSoft chirpsCockatielLittle10-15 yearsHighWhistles, [graupapageien-Training](https://chinabadge3.bravejournal.net/3-reasons-the-reasons-for-your-parrot-information-is-broken-and-how-to-repair) chatterLovebirdLittle10-15 yearsHighSoft chirpsAfrican GreyMedium40-60 yearsVery highSubstantial vocabularyAmazon ParrotMedium25-50 yearsHighLoud and expressiveGetting Ready For Parrot Adoption

Contrary to popular belief, adopting a parrot from a shelter is workable and uncomplicated. Here's a quick overview of the steps involved:
Visit a Shelter: Research regional shelters or parrot rescue organizations and set up a see to satisfy the birds.Total an Application: Fill out an adoption application to reveal your objectives and provide your background.Interview: Most shelters carry out interviews to evaluate your readiness and match you with a suitable bird.Home Visit: Some shelters may require a home check out to ensure your living conditions are suitable for a parrot.Adoption Fee: Upon approval, you'll typically require to pay an adoption charge, which might differ by company.Post-Adoption Support: Many shelters provide post-adoption resources to assist you shift into parrot ownership.Frequently asked questions
